Governor reaches out to people of North Sikkim

MANGAN: Following his tour of Mangan District, Governor Om Prakash Mathur visited Tasa Tengay Government Senior Secondary School in Chungthang on September 22.
Upon his arrival, he was welcomed by Mr Samdup Lepcha, Minister Social Welfare, Women & Child Development and Printing & Stationery departments, along with SDM, BDO and other officials.
The programme commenced with a welcome address delivered by SDM Chungthang, Mr Arun Chettri.
In his speech, Governor Om Prakash Mathur expressed gratitude to the locals for their welcome during his visit to Mangan District. He commended the residents for their resilience in the face of recent disasters, recognising their efforts to rebuild and support one another. He acknowledged the challenges they have faced and noted the strength of the community in overcoming difficulties.
The Governor emphasised the importance of unity and cooperation as essential elements in the recovery process and encouraged continued collaboration among residents to restore normalcy.
He assured the community that he would talk to the central government to secure support for the affected areas. He mentioned the development plans set out by Prime Minister Mr Narendra Modi for the Northeast region.
He said that these initiatives aim to improve infrastructure, support local economies and enhance the quality of life for residents. He expressed his commitment to ensuring that the needs of the community are met and that assistance reaches those who require it most.
In conclusion, the Governor acknowledged the Chief Minister and the legislature for their efforts in promoting developmental initiatives across Sikkim.
Minister Mr Samdup Lepcha, in his address, expressed gratitude to the Governor for his visit to Mangan District. He presented details of the damage caused by recent floods, highlighting the loss of life, destruction of property and disruption to road connectivity, as well as the impact on local flora and fauna.
Minister Lepcha outlined the government’s schemes aimed at supporting the affected areas and detailed ongoing projects focused on sustainable tourism development within the district. He emphasised the importance of these initiatives in promoting economic recovery and providing assistance to those impacted by the floods.
DC Mangan, Mr Anant Jain (IAS) offered a brief overview of the geographical features and tourism potential of Mangan District. He detailed the impacts of the recent floods, including the displacement of residents and economic losses due to damaged infrastructure.
Panchayat President Chunthang GPU, Ms Diki Lepcha, also expressed gratitude to the Governor for his visit. She presented the challenges faced by residents due to the flooding and discussed the recovery and support initiatives provided by the state government.

Also present were Zilla Panchayat, ADC Chungthang, Additional Secretary to Governor, BDO Chungthang, ASP Chungthang, officials, BRO officials and locals.
The programme concluded with an interactive session that included students, teachers and local residents.
The Governor addressed concerns about flood damage and assured possible support for recovery efforts.
